Understanding the physical quality of soil that influences
its hydraulic behaviour helps in formulating
appropriate water management strategies for sustainable
crop production. Saturated hydraulic conductivity
(Ks) is a key factor governing the hydraulic properties of
soils. Ks can be estimated through various techniques. In
the present article we have developed and validated the
regression models to predict Ks of the soils of the Indo-
Gangetic Plains (IGP) and the black soil regions (BSR)
under different bioclimatic systems. While particle size
distribution was found to be a key factor to predict Ks
of the BSR soils, organic carbon was found useful for
the IGP soils. Moreover, the models for Ks of both
soils were strengthened by putting in CaCO3 and
exchangeable sodium percentage content. It seems
there is ample scope to study the interaction process
for revising Ks to desired levels through management
practices in these two important food-growing zones.
An index of soil physical quality, derived from the
inflection points of the soil moisture characteristic
curves could well explain the impact of management
practices on soil physical quality.
